首页 > TAG信息列表 > 事件驱动

事件驱动&时间驱动

事件驱动 事件驱动看文字就够了! 我的理解and一些实现想法: 程序不通过循环监听实现事件发生的方式为事件驱动。 具体化就是程序本身有一个主循环体用于接收UI触发的事件,每触发一次循环次数加一,深入循环内部,会对事件进行处理,处理完成后将结果返回以及循环标记位减一,直至标记位为0,循

云原生事件驱动引擎(RocketMQ-EventBridge)应用场景与技术解析

作者:罗静 在刚刚过去的 RocketMQ Summit 2022 全球开发者峰会上,我们对外正式开源了我们的新产品 RocketMQ-Eventbridge 事件驱动引擎。 RocketMQ 给人最大的印象一直是一个消息引擎。那什么是事件驱动引擎?为什么我们这次要推出事件驱动引擎这个产品?他有哪些应用场景,以及对应的技

最强分布式事务框架怎么炼成的?

一、什么是事件驱动架构 事件驱动架构是一种促进生产的软件架构范式。事件驱动架构在用微服务构建的现代应用中非常普遍,它用事件来触发、解耦服务之间的通信。事件可以是状态的变更,比如将商品放入购物车;也可以是某种标识,比如订单的发货通知。 在传统的软件架构中,应用逻辑是通过请

事件驱动优化:理论

EBO 的理论和强化学习很像,也是 value function(性能势)和 Q function(Q 因子)。 估计熟悉 RL 的朋友已经想象出画面了,但是要注意三点: value function 不代表 “特定状态下的预期收益”,而是 “特定事件发生后的预期收益”;同样,Q function 代表 “特定事件发生后、做出特定动作的预期收

【Paper】2015_多智能体系统的事件驱动一致性控制与多 Lagrangian 系统的分布式协同

[2015_多智能体系统的事件驱动一致性控制 与多 Lagrangian 系统的分布式协同] 文章目录 第6章 多 Lagrangian 系统的事件驱动一致性控制 第6章 多 Lagrangian 系统的事件驱动一致性控制

事件驱动组件Eventing

  Autoscaler计算Pod数的基本逻辑 指标收集周期与决策周期   ◼ Autoscaler每2秒钟计算一次Revision上所需要Pod实例数量   ◼ Autoscaler每2秒钟从Revision的Pod实例(Quueu-Proxy容器)上抓取一次指标数据,并将其(每秒的)平均值存储于单独的bucket中     ◆实例较少时,则从每个

带你自定义实现Spring事件驱动模型

Spring 事件驱动模型概念 Spring 事件驱动模型就是观察者模式很经典的一个应用,我们可以通过Spring 事件驱动模型来完成代码的解耦。 三角色 Spring 事件驱动模型或者说观察者模式需要三个类角色来支撑完成。分表是: 事件——ApplicationEvent 事件监听者——ApplicationListener

基于 ASK + EB 构建容器事件驱动服务

简介:本篇文章以“在线文件解压场景”为例为大家展示经典 EDA 事件驱动与容器如何搭配使用。 作者:冬岛、肯梦 导读 EDA 事件驱动架构( Event-Driven Architecture ) 是一种系统架构模型,它的核心能力在于能够发现系统“事件”或重要的业务时刻(例如交易节点、站点访问等)并实时或接近

5. 微服务的事件驱动管理@微服务的设计与实现

5. 微服务的事件驱动管理 这是本电子书的第五章,内容涉及使用微服务构建应用程序。第一章介绍了微服务架构模式,并讨论了使用微服务的优点和缺点。第二章和第三章描述了微服务架构内部通信的不同方面。第四章探索了服务发现紧密相关的问题。在这章,我们换个角度,看看微服务架构中

nodejs 异步 I/O 和事件驱动

异步IO(asynchronous I/O) 阻塞I/O 和 非阻塞I/O 阻塞I/O,就是当用户发一个读取文件描述符的操作的时候,进程就会被阻塞,直到要读取的数据全部准备好返回给用户,这时候进程才会解除block的状态。 非阻塞I/O,就与上面的情况相反,用户发起一个读取文件描述符操作的时,函数立即返回,不作任何

TriggerMesh 开源强大的事件驱动的集成平台

TriggerMesh 是基于k8s&knative 的事件驱动的开发集成平台,我们可以基于声明式的方式进行数据集成处理可以让我们实现集成组件即代码,TriggerMesh 基于hcl 配置搞了一套自己的定义语言(hcl 本来就对于定义配置比较友好) TriggerMesh 的组件 TriggerMesh 主要包含了以下组件(一切基于ev

事件驱动模型

事件驱动和异步I/O 通常,服务器处理模型有以下几种: 接收到请求,创建新的进程处理接收到请求,创建新的线程处理接收到请求后,放入一个事件列表,让主进程通过非阻塞I/O方式处理请求 第1种方法,由于创建新的进程的开销比较大,所以,会导致服务器性能比较差,但实现比较简单。 第2种方式,由于要

业务重构时用事件驱动模式

前言 需求:当新用户注册时,需要给用户发放各种礼品、积分、短信、邀请人奖励等。 常见写法 直接将上述后续操作堆到注册方法里,搞的注册方法又臭又长;当有其他注册如app注册、小程序注册、第三方注册时,然后将同样的发放逻辑复制的到处都是,可读性、维护性极差 优化:可以将发放逻

基于 RocketMQ 构建阿里云事件驱动引擎EventBridge

基于 RocketMQ 构建阿里云事件驱动引擎EventBridge https://mp.weixin.qq.com/s/OUAuQCm3mITlOhx3amvPTA 原创 尘央 阿里巴巴中间件 2021-11-04 作者:尘央审核&校对:白玙 编辑&排版:酒圆 以 Kubernetes 为基础设施的云原生技术,彻底改变了我们的开发和思维模式。事件作为云原生领域

阿里云消息队列 RocketMQ 5.0 全新升级:消息、事件、流融合处理平台

从“消息”到“消息、事件、流”的大融合   消息队列作为当代应用的通信基础设施,微服务架构应用的核心依赖,通过异步解耦能力让用户更高效地构建分布式、高性能、弹性健壮的应用程序。   从数据价值和业务价值角度来看,消息队列的价值不断深化。消息队列中流动的业务核心数据涉及

阿里云消息队列 RocketMQ 5.0 全新升级:消息、事件、流融合处理平台

从“消息”到“消息、事件、流”的大融合 消息队列作为当代应用的通信基础设施,微服务架构应用的核心依赖,通过异步解耦能力让用户更高效地构建分布式、高性能、弹性健壮的应用程序。 从数据价值和业务价值角度来看,消息队列的价值不断深化。消息队列中流动的业务核心数据涉及集

编程模型

深入理解重要的编程模型 目录1. 事件驱动1.1. 为什么采用事件驱动模型?1.2. 深入理解事件驱动1.2.1. 异步处理和主动轮训1.2.2. IO模型1.2.3. 常用的事件驱动框架2. 消息驱动3. 数据驱动3.1. 隐含在背后的思想3.2. 数据驱动编程可以用来做什么3.2.1. 表驱动法(Table-Driven)3.2.

EventEmitter事件驱动通讯

ionic4.x 中使用 EventEmitter 事件驱动实现页面通讯 1 Eventemitter Github 地址:https://github.com/primus/eventemitter3 2、安装配置 EventEmitter:npm install --save eventemitter3 3、定义公共的服务配置 EventEmitter:import { Injectable} from '@angular/core';import {Ev

EDA 事件驱动架构与 EventBridge 二三事

​简介: 事件驱动型架构 (EDA) 方兴未艾,作为一种 Serverless 化的应用概念对云原生架构具有着深远影响。当我们讨论到一个具体架构时,首当其冲的是它的发展是否具有技术先进性。这里从我们熟悉的 MVC 架构,SOA 架构谈起,聊一聊关于消息事件领域的历史与发展趋势。 作者|肯梦 当下比较

给js的事件驱动函数添加快捷键

1.原理    2.实际案例 超链接跳转 <html> <head> <script> function accesskey() { document.getElementById('w3s').accessKey="w" } </script> </head> <!-- onload()方法是页面完全加载后可触发 --!> <body onload=&

Spring 事件驱动,自定义事件监听

目录 概述源码分析ApplicationEvent 应用事件spring中常见的事件类型ApplicationListener 事件监听器ApplicationEventPublisher 事件发布器 实际使用自定义事件编写事件监听器发布事件   概述 spring引入了事件机制,支持 ApplicationEvent(应用事件),可以对指定事件进

jQuery 点击事件驱动获取值

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-

jquery的点击事件驱动获取值

<!DOCTYPE html> <html lang="en"> <head>     <meta charset="UTF-8">     <meta name="viewport"         content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-

6 种事件驱动的架构模式

在过去一年里,我一直是数据流团队的一员,负责Wix事件驱动的消息传递基础设施(基于 Kafka)。有超过 1400 个微服务使用这个基础设施。在此期间,我实现或目睹了事件驱动消息传递设计的几个关键模式,这些模式有助于创建一个健壮的分布式系统,该系统可以轻松地处理不断增长的流量和存储需求

【转】Stateful Functions 2.0 基于Apache Flink的事件驱动数据库

Stateful Functions 基于Apache Flink的事件驱动数据库 转自:https://blog.csdn.net/yanyan45/article/details/105622238 原文:https://flink.apache.org/news/2020/04/07/release-statefun-2.0.0.html#event-driven-database-vs-requestresponse-database 应用流式处理的事件驱